How to Make a Coffee-Free Frappuccino

Making a coffee-free Frappuccino is similar to making a traditional Frappuccino, with a few modifications. Here’s a basic recipe for a coffee-free Frappuccino:

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up of tea, chocolate, or fruit puree
  • 1 cup of milk
  • 1 cup of ice
  • 1 tablespoon of honey or sugar (optional)
  • 1/4 teaspoon of vanilla extract (optional)
  • Whipped cream or non-dairy alternative (optional)

Instructions:

  1. In a blender, combine the tea, chocolate, or fruit puree, milk, and ice.
  2. Blend the mixture on high speed until it’s smooth and creamy.
  3. Add honey or sugar and vanilla extract, if desired, and blend until well combined.
  4. Pour the mixture into a glass and top with whipped cream or a non-dairy alternative, if desired.

Recipes for Coffee-Free Frappuccinos

Here are a few recipes for coffee-free Frappuccinos:

Strawberry Frappuccino

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up of strawberry puree
  • 1 cup of milk
  • 1 cup of ice
  • 1 tablespoon of honey
  • 1/4 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• Whipped cream (optional)

Instructions:

  1. In a blender, combine the strawberry puree, milk, and ice.
  2. Blend the mixture on high speed until it’s smooth and creamy.
  3. Add honey and vanilla extract, if desired, and blend until well combined.
  4. Pour the mixture into a glass and top with whipped cream, if desired.

Chocolate Frappuccino

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up of chocolate syrup
  • 1 cup of milk
  • 1 cup of ice
  • 1 tablespoon of sugar
  • 1/4 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• Whipped cream (optional)

Instructions:

  1. In a blender, combine the chocolate syrup, milk, and ice.
  2. Blend the mixture on high speed until it’s smooth and creamy.
  3. Add sugar and vanilla extract, if desired, and blend until well combined.
  4. Pour the mixture into a glass and top with whipped cream, if desired.

What are some alternatives to coffee in a Frappuccino?

If you want to make a Frappuccino without coffee, there are several alternatives you can use as a base. Tea is a popular option, with flavors like green tea, chai, or earl grey working well in a Frappuccino. You can also use flavored syrups, such as vanilla, hazelnut, or caramel, to create a unique taste profile. Another option is to use cocoa powder or melted chocolate to create a chocolate-based Frappuccino.

Other alternatives to coffee include using fruit purees, such as banana or mango, to create a fruity and refreshing drink. You can also experiment with spices, such as cinnamon or nutmeg, to add depth and warmth to your Frappuccino. When using alternatives to coffee, keep in mind that the flavor and texture may differ from a traditional Frappuccino, so feel free to experiment and adjust the ingredients to your taste.

Are coffee-free Frappuccinos healthier than traditional Frappuccinos?

Coffee-free Frappuccinos can be a healthier option than traditional Frappuccinos, depending on the ingredients used. By avoiding coffee, you can reduce the caffeine content of the drink, which may be beneficial for those who are sensitive to caffeine. Additionally, using alternative ingredients like tea or fruit purees can provide a boost of antioxidants and other nutrients.

However, it’s also important to consider the other ingredients used in a coffee-free Frappuccino, such as sugar, cream, and syrups. These ingredients can add calories and sugar to the drink, making it less healthy. To make a healthier coffee-free Frappuccino, consider using low-fat milk, natural sweeteners, and minimal amounts of syrup or cream.
